Bond receives a golden bullet engraved with the numbers 007 — the calling card of Francisco Scaramanga (Christopher Lee), an assassin who charges a million dollars a kill and fires a pistol he assembles from a cigarette case, a lighter, a pen and a cufflink. The case ties into the hunt for the Solex Agitator, a device that could weaponise solar power. With Mary Goodnight (Britt Ekland) at his side, Bond follows the trail from Hong Kong and Bangkok to Scaramanga's private island, where a hall of mirrors and a one-on-one duel are waiting. Along the way comes the famous spiral car jump, a full 360-degree corkscrew across a broken bridge.
